1. 概述
1.1 应用场景
本文将介绍如何连接 Postgresql 数据库,将数据库中的数据获取到产品中进行分析。
1.2 收集连接信息
在连接数据库之前,请收集以下信息:
数据库所在服务器的 IP 地址和端口号;
数据库的名称;
数据库的用户名和密码;
要连接的数据库模式;
1.3 使用前提
本产品与 Postgresql 数据库对接,必须确保网络畅通。
因此,在数据连接前,请将相关服务器IP「47.110.75.116」加入到目标数据库访问的白名单中。
2. 操作步骤
2.1 添加数据源
1)进入数据连接市场,新增「Postgresql」数据源。如下图所示:
2)在弹窗中填写相关配置信息,具体说明如下表所示:
配置 | 介绍 |
---|---|
数据库类型 | 可切换成其他数据库类型 |
数据库名称 | 输入要连接的数据库的名字 |
主机 | 输入数据库所在主机(或服务器)的 IP |
端口 | 输入数据库所在主机(或服务器)的端口 |
用户名/密码 | 输入数据库的用户名和密码 |
编码 | 推荐使用默认,可以选择其他编码 |
模式 | 要连接的数据库模式 |
数据连接URL | 自动生成的 URL ,无需特意配置。 如果从别处复制 URL 并粘贴,主机、端口、数据库名称可以自动识别填写。 |
3)填写配置信息后,点击左下角的「测试连接」,若连接成功则点击「确定」,如下图所示:
2.2 选择数据库表
1)点击「确定」后,可以勾选需要导入的数据库表。如下图所示:
后期还可以导入更多数据库原始表或者SQL表,参见本文第 4 节。
2)这样就成功地添加了数据库表了。如下图所示:
这里仅展示已添加到产品中的数据表,未添加过的表是不会展示在数据源界面的。请重复添加表操作,将数据库中的表添加到产品中。
2.3 数据源协作
数据源的创建者默认拥有数据源的管理权限,管理者可将此数据源分配给其他成员使用。
点击「权限设置」按钮,在弹窗中即可自定义配置数据源权限,详情参见文档:数据源权限设置
2.4 使用数据
连接好数据源并同步数据后,下一步,需要将数据保存在「分析展示」模块的项目中,进一步地分析。
3. 数据同步
数据源界面的数据是实时更新的,但如果将数据添加到项目中使用,项目中的数据不是实时更新的,需要将数据源界面的数据「同步」到项目中。
可以对使用的数据表手动同步表单,或者设置单表定时同步,设置开始时间以及执行频率。详情参见文档:同步数据
4. 添加更多表
若后期还需要添加数据库中的表,鼠标悬浮在节点上,点击节点旁边的「+」按钮,可以添加数据库原始表或者自定义 SQL 表,如下图所示:
4.1 添加数据库原始表
如果选择添加「数据库原始表」,在列表中选择想要导入的数据表,点击「确定」,数据表就导入产品中了,如下图所示:
4.2 自定义 SQL 表
选择「自定义 SQL 表」,在弹窗中可自定义 SQL,点击「刷新预览」,可在弹窗下方预览数据,如下图所示:
5. 编辑数据连接
如果想要修改数据库配置信息,可点击「编辑连接」按钮进行修改,如下图所示: